Frequently Asked Questions about East Boston

How much are Studio apartments in East Boston?

There are currently 373 Studio Apartments in East Boston with rent ranges from $1,550 to $20,000 with an average price of $3,084.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om East Boston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in East Boston ranges from $1,000 to $20,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,337.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in East Boston c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in East Boston range from $1,800 to $27,675.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,932.

How expensive are East Boston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 579 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in East Boston on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,450 to $45,000 - averaging $4,828 for the location.
